If the maturity date, redemption date or an interest payment date for any note is not a business day (as that term is defined in the prospectus), principal, premium, if any, and interest for that note is paid on the next business day, and no interest will accrue from, and after, the maturity date, redemption date or interest payment date (following unadjusted business day convention).

* The survivor's option feature of your note is subject to important limitations, restrictions and procedural requirements further described on page S-32 of your prospectus supplement.

The Bank of New York will act as trustee for the Notes. Citibank, N.A., will act as paying agent, registrar and transfer agent for the Notes and will administer any survivor's options with respect thereto.

Notes will be sold to you at the selling price specified in this Pricing Supplement. The Purchasing Agent shall purchase notes from us at the selling price less the applicable gross concession specified in this Pricing Supplement. The Purchasing Agent may resell the notes it purchases to the agents and selected dealers at the selling price less a concession that, at the discretion of the Purchasing Agent, may be less than or equal to the gross concession received by the Purchasing Agent. Notes purchased by the agents and selected dealers on behalf of level-fee investment advisory accounts may be sold to such accounts at the selling price less the applicable concession, and such agents and selected dealers shall not retain, as compensation, any portion of such concession applicable to such selling agents and dealers. In that instance, the Purchasing Agent may retain the portion of the gross concession applicable to the Purchasing Agent.
